Wire Bondable
Resistor Network Arrays
Chip Network Array Series
·
·
·
·
Absolute tolerances to ±0.1%
Tight TCR tracking to ±5ppm/°C
Ratio match tolerances to ±0.05%
Ultra-stable tantalum nitride resistors
IRC’s TaNSil
®
network array resistors are ideally suited for applications that demand a small footprint. The small wire
bondable chip package provides higher component density, lower resistor cost and high reliability.
The tantalum nitride film system on silicon provides precision tolerance, exceptional TCR tracking and low cost.
Excellent performance in harsh, humid environments is a trademark of IRC’s self-passivating TaNSil
®
resistor film.
For applications requiring high performance resistor networks in a low cost, wire bondable package, specify IRC
network array die.
